I wish you could have scene some stuff from the days of Mindy(Billy's daughter)/Phillip/Beth/Rick. Their history is larger than life basically. This site might help a little. http://www.soapcentral.com/gl/whoswho/index.php

Yep Rick has always been in love with Beth. Beth was Rick's date to prom 20 something years ago. Their romance would have continued, but Beth developed feelings for Alan's son, Rick's best friend, Phillip. When Beth ran away to NYC to get away from her abusive stepfather, it was Phillip who was at her side and the two fell in love there basically.
